HOUSTON -- Was Roland Carnaby a member of the U.S. intelligence community or a would-be spy? The mystery widens in the case of the man who claimed to be a CIA operative who was shot and killed by Houston police following a high-speed chase on Tuesday.
In fact, the only thing sure about the mystery surrounding Carnaby is that chase and fatal shooting.
"When we do an investigation like this and you have so much mystery involved, said Houston Police Chief Harold Hurtt, who said he didnt know who Carnaby was, even after a photo of the two from a Houston Policemans Ball was given to 11 News by Carnabys family. And the fact that the individual is dead, and we want to make sure that we are doing a good job and give you accurate information."
